摘要
本文以油菜为试材,用FAAS法对受Cd污染土壤中的全量Cd、有效态Cd以及油菜茎叶中的Cd含量进行了测定与分析。同时对土壤全量Cd、有效态Cd及茎叶中Cd的样品予处理方法进行了比较研究。结果表明,方法回收率在96%以上,样品测定的相对标准偏差小于3.97%。本方法快速、准确、干扰少。
The analytical and testing centre the total cadmium(Cd) and the available Cd contents in different Cd polluted soils were measured by FAAS.The Cd content in the stems and leaves of cole was tested in the same way.The methods of sample pretreatment for the total Cd and available Cd in soils and in cole were compared respectively.The standard sample recovery rates were all above 96 percent,and the relative standard deviations were less than 3 97 percent.The FAAS is rapid and accurate.
